The ideal frames for riding dirt tracks are the ones having longer backs and narrow fronts, vice versa to concrete and asphalt. It is also known as a kart, a gearbox/shifter kart, and an off-road buggy. Zipping through the dirt could cut power to the engine while cutting a turn. A go-kart is a small vehicle with a simple design, a small body build, four wheels, brakes, and an automotive engine. For instance, dirt track frames should include a longer back rail and a short front rail.ĭirt tracks put a lot of challenge and stress on the front rail and stiff back rails. The first consideration when building a go cart, is what materials will be used to build the frame, and how the frame will. Whether it’s dirt, concrete or asphalt, various kinds of frames perform differently based on the surface. Picking the right frame for your go kart could vary on the surface you’re riding on. Frames must be done from light materials, helping you boost the speed of your go kart. The ideal types of frames are the ones, which provide the driver with the best safety possible. If you’re the kind of person who wants projects you could build at home, then you will more likely to enjoy assembling your own go kart from pre-welded metals. Frames could be built from a wide array of material such as rubber, metal, hard plastic, or wood.
